- The Cool Notes were a mid-1980s pop/funk group who had a string of chart hits in the UK between 1984 and 1986. The band, which formed in South London, consisted of seven members of both vocal and instrumental talent. They are best known for their UK number 11 hit, "Spend the Night". (en)
